Itinerary
Days 1-3
Walk coastal trails lined with olive groves and terraced vineyards • Discover Cinque Terre’s World Heritage coastline by foot and by train, from colorful Riomaggiore to the beaches of Monterosso • Choose highland hikes for panoramic views or linger in cliffside towns like Manarola and Vernazza • Follow scenic paths past painted villas into chic Portofino • Explore the vibrant harborfront of Santa Margherita Ligure and the Golfo del Tigullio • Swim, sunbathe and unwind at our welcoming Ligurian hideaway • Savor Ligurian cuisine with sea views and fresh Mediterranean flavors.

Days 4-6
Trade sea views for Tuscan vineyards as we head inland to Chianti’s timeless landscapes • Hike through Greve, Montefioralle and Panzano, pausing for farm-fresh lunches and rich reds • Wander the medieval streets of Radda, the heart of Chianti Classico • Enjoy a signature Backroads picnic at Castelvecchi’s 1,000-year-old cellars • Walk the strada bianca through olive groves and cypress-studded hills • Wind down each night at a peaceful hilltop retreat • Extend your journey with a visit to Florence, Italy’s Renaissance jewel.

We want to make sure you're on the trip that's right for you. Every Backroads trip is unique and this one is no exception.
Cinque Terre is a popular tourist destination with busy peak seasons including summer months and on national holidays. During these periods, crowds are common. To access the best hiking areas in the Cinque Terre, we will sometimes be riding on state-operated regional trains alongside locals and other tourists. The trains can be subject to delays and crowded during peak seasons. Because the national park is still recovering from trail damage from previous years, closures may occur. In the event of a trail closure, your Backroads Trip Leaders will have alternate hikes and activities available. For more information on the park and trail closures, please visit www.parconazionale5terre.it.
Our routes through this captivating region follow mostly narrow trails, with occasional technical sections featuring roots, stones or steps. Because of the nature of these coastal paths, vehicle support won’t be available on some days. Alternative options to move along the coast—such as local trains or ferries—are always available.
